The 2018 Honda Pilot doesn't have power folding mirrors as standard, except on the elite trim levels that usually come with a higher price tag of around $10,000 extra. However, you have the option to add power mirrors to the 2018 model yourself. The cost for installing power folding mirrors can range from $200 to $260, depending on whether you choose an aftermarket or OEM product. You will need tools such as a 10mm socket, socket extender, torx screwdriver, pliers, and cutting pliers for installation. Additionally, you'll need to purchase a switch for the vehicle, which can be bought from a dealership. Service manuals are available to guide you through the mirror installation process.
